History:
The surname Gavade is believed to have originated in India, particularly among Marathi-speaking communities. It is widely used in the state of Maharashtra, as well as parts of Goa and Karnataka. While the exact mythological origin of the surname is unclear, it may have ties to the Maratha warrior tradition, as some bearers of the name are associated with the Maratha community. Historically, the surname may have been adopted by those who served in military or administrative capacities, and the name itself could be linked to the term "Gav" (meaning village or settlement in Marathi), suggesting a connection to landowners or village heads.
In terms of political and social mobilization, Gavades are primarily found in rural and urban Maharashtra, with significant involvement in agriculture, administration, and trade. The community has also played a role in regional politics, particularly in the Maratha-dominated regions. Migration patterns indicate a spread from Maharashtra to neighboring states like Gujarat and Madhya Pradesh, with notable communities in urban centers like Pune and Mumbai.
Description:
The Gavade surname is found predominantly in Maharashtra, with sub-communities also existing in Goa, Karnataka, and Madhya Pradesh. Marathi is the most commonly spoken language, though some may also speak Konkani or Kannada in areas where the community has migrated. Ganesh Chaturthi and Diwali are widely celebrated festivals among the Gavade community, alongside regional festivals like Makar Sankranti. Noble personalities with the Gavade surname have been involved in both administrative and cultural spheres, with some contributing significantly to the military and freedom struggle.
Family values in the Gavade community emphasize respect for elders, education, and strong ties to rural life. Traditional foods include puran poli, vade, and various Maharashtrian sweets. The community places a high value on education, with a relatively high literacy rate, especially in urban centres. Occupations traditionally include agriculture, trading, and governmental services, though many in the younger generation have moved into professional fields like engineering, medicine, and law.
